d. Saratoga Creek Bridge (Long Bridge)
Stransky reported to the Commission that the Long Bridge, which is located in the
County, is in danger of being taken down. Caltrans has prepared a DEIR regarding the
bridge and comments for the DEIR are due March 29, 2018. It was anticipated that the
County Historical Heritage Commission is opposed to losing the bridge. Direction from
staff was that since the bridge is in the County, comments could not come from HPC but
the commissioners could provide comments as individual members of the public. The
Commission requested staff to obtain additional directions regarding this matter as the
Commission felt that they should be taking an active role in supporting the County on
this matter.
e. Work plan format discussion
The Commission commented that the work plan excel sheet hasn’t been updated correctly
and is not organized well. Staff will review and modify the format and update the
document. Items discussed to be added to the work plan included the outcome from the
joint meeting with the City Council which included input on the history of the utility box
painting and adding the trees along Quito Rd/Marshall Lane to the heritage tree
inventory. The Commission determined that the item regarding mapping the existing tree
plaques was not the role of the HPC as the trees are not heritage trees and those plaques
are handled through the Public Works Dept. Suggested that the trees on Saratoga-
Sunnyvale Road, near the Saratoga High School Theater, may be candidates for the
Heritage Tree Inventory.
